Pathologic high activity of osteoclasts and repression of bone osteoblastic bone formation result in bone metabolic diseases such as periodontal disease. To understand the mechanism of osteoblast and osteoclast function leads to establishment of therapy for bone metabolic disease. A tyrosine kinase Src deficient mice shows osteopetrosis because of defect bone resorbing activity and acceleration bone formation. This indicates Src is a key molecule to regulate bone resorption and bone formation. We discuss about the role of Src in osteoclast and osteoblast and entire bone metabolism.}
